Singapore shares began trading in positive territory today, after US stocks inched up overnight.
In the morning, the Straits Times Index (STI) opened 0.2 per cent higher at 3,328.91 points after 47.1 million securities changed hands in the broader market.
In terms of companies to watch for today, we have Seatrium after the firm announced that its director Lai Chung Han will resign on the 30th of June.
Elsewhere, from more on SIA and compensation for affected passengers on the turbulence hit SQ321 flight, to Apple and Open AI’s partnership to bring ChatGPT technology to the phone maker’s devices, more corporate headlines are in focus today.
On Market View, The Evening Runway’s finance presenter Chua Tian Tian unpacked the developments with Prashant Dagur, Investment Counselor Team Lead at Citi Private Bank.
